输入字段:预填充值不可删除,但可扩展

时间:2012-06-05 10:04:46

标签: javascript jquery input

由于我对JavaScript并不熟悉,所以我在网上进行了一些研究。继续,但无法解决我的问题。

我创建了一个fiddle来向您展示它的外观。 好吧,我的问题是浅灰色的预填充值“电子邮件”不能删除,但值本身应该可以用黑色字体颜色扩展。

你知道如何实现它吗?

谢谢。

2 个答案:

答案 0 :(得分:2)

试试这个

http://jsfiddle.net/wf9zX/2/

为该输入字段使用label,并使用concat输入字段值和标签文本

答案 1 :(得分:0)

解决方案1 ​​

为什么不使用两种不同风格的输入?您可以禁用或使第一个只读,并仍然连接两个输入POST值。

我不认为INSIDE输入的样式非常适合W3C。

解决方案2

在输入中使用背景图像(写入“电子邮件”的图像)并使用左侧填充。当你得到POSt值时,只需添加字符串“E-mail”即可。这就像他们在输入上做了cutom搜索按钮图标。

看到新的小提琴:http://jsfiddle.net/gxY5P/4/

希望这有帮助。